Irving Oil's New Brunswick refinery, Canada's biggest, drops 2020 carbon cut pledge: documents

Irving Oil, operator of Canada’s largest oil refinery, has abandoned a pledge to cut carbon output by 17% from 2005 levels by 2020, replacing it instead with a goal to keep its performance on climate change competitive with rivals, according to documents reviewed by Reuters.
